The Changing Designs and styles of Denim Jean Skirts
Denim jean skirts will be the most famous form of wear with youths, teenagers, and women. Since their inception, denim skirts make the wearer appear sophisticated, stylish and attractive with a casual look. Jean skirts are highly well-liked by most ladies because of their flexibility as they are lovely to wear at all-weather conditions. The slacks also improve the self-esteem of an individual particularly when the individuals do not like to show their curves as the materials used to manufacture denim pants are heavy. Jean skirts may also be illustrious because of their lovely and appealing look, making them appropriate in most occasions.

Denim jean skirts are manufactured with a versatile material which makes them comfortable to wear and touch. Therefore, denim skirts could be worn in a workplace, a day out, or a day in-house and therefore, their usability is versatile. The jeans have interesting characteristics that make them appealing and admirable. The prominent feature of denim is their toughness but in a fashionable look. The other imperative feature of denim skirts is their always in fashion style. Since their inception, some years back, denim jeans have always been a trademark in the style industry. The history of denim skirts goes back to mid 1800's.

Levi Strauss is the personality behind the contraption of skinny jeans known as Levi's jeans, that have been famous in 1950's. The fashionable Levi's jeans were made with cotton duck and stronger denim textile and had the designer's name. The later denim pants designs saw the duck material dropped as consumers found jean miniskirts more appealing especially after washing. Denim washing creates a pleasant faded bloom on the exquisite blue dyeing which makes them appearing to most admirers. The popularity of Levi's skinny jeans in the 1950's saw new designers such as Wranglers and Lee Coopers start their own jean miniskirts designs.

In the style scene, the popularity of denim pants is highly accredited to 1950's film stars who wore them in movies. This saw denim pants become popular with many youths and teenagers who watched the movies. Denim jeans In the old days, the denim jean miniskirts were worn as work garments however in 1940's; the denim pants were viewed as leisure clothes in America. By 1970's, individuals started to personalize their jeans denim with texts embroidery, studs, graffiti, and floral decorations amongst others. Moreover, in this era, the old jeans were recycled to generate patchwork jean skirt. Later in 1970's, Nick Kamen associated the denim jeans with a sexual allure.

The growth of denim jean skirts continued in 1980's with torn, ripped and frayed jeans being many of the most prevalent type of wear. It had been in this era when colored denim became popular but in 1990's black denim became the steadfast jean fashion. However, regardless of the changing years, blue faded pants always remain as prevalent in the fashion scene. In 2000's the frayed slashes and rip tears were probably the most widespread jean wear. Today, denim jean miniskirts come in great shapes, designs, sizes and styles.
